Output 58e3be98112ea31906cf645c640f462261db2ec9511bca5cfff74c3c246a3578:3

value
6716368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ac56d41782f1ce91b4116d8b10e857dec245ccda OP_EQUAL
address
MPcQUNdqcQ94Xs7nAeeCsECkY2e22jC1RE
transaction
58e3be98112ea31906cf645c640f462261db2ec9511bca5cfff74c3c246a3578
spent
true